A Toslink optical cable is a high-quality digital audio cable that transmits audio signals in the form of light. It is commonly used to connect devices such as TVs, sound systems, and gaming consoles to provide superior sound quality without interference from electrical signals.

This innovative cable uses fiber optic technology to transmit high-quality audio signals, ensuring that you enjoy crystal-clear sound without any interference. Whether you're connecting your television to a soundbar or linking your gaming console to a surround sound system, a Toslink optical cable provides a reliable and efficient solution.

One of the standout features of the Toslink optical cable is its ability to deliver digital audio signals over long distances without degradation. This makes it perfect for home theater setups where your devices might be spaced apart. Additionally, the optical design means that you won't have to worry about electromagnetic interference, which can often affect traditional copper cables.

A Toslink optical cable is used to transmit digital audio signals between devices such as TVs, sound systems, and gaming consoles.

No, Toslink optical cables are designed specifically for audio transmission and do not support video signals.

The advantages include high-quality audio transmission, immunity to electromagnetic interference, and the ability to transmit signals over long distances without degradation.

You need devices with optical audio ports to use a Toslink optical cable, such as soundbars, receivers, or TVs.

Simply plug one end of the Toslink optical cable into the optical output of your device and the other end into the optical input of the receiving device.
